Output 61e739bfa5d21998d64650943233907e193a3858b1668ecd0fe8f09cce596526:1

value
8559000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 207b5346bbdafbaf87dae3f97b76912de025eeb9 OP_EQUAL
address
34emHUTf1YRdFng5yJWP216m5kVqBy9GCf
transaction
61e739bfa5d21998d64650943233907e193a3858b1668ecd0fe8f09cce596526
confirmations
324240
spent
true